DADS READ: “My Cat Looks Like My Dad” by Thao Lam

Image
JER: “ My Cat Looks Like My Dad ” by Thao Lam is Ejler’s new favorite book.  The last three nights she has carried it in, while excitedly saying: “my cats looks my dad”, in her still developing English skills.  I love the simple lines and use of patterns that seems like an homage to scrapbooking.  Most of all, I love the sentiment that “FAMILY is what you make it”.

DADS READ: “A Hungry Lion or A Dwindling Assortment of Animals” by Lucy Ruth Cummins

Image
JER: “ A Hungry Lion or A Dwindling Assortment of Animals ” by Lucy Ruth Cummins is perfectly summed up by one of my other favorite authors: “So smart and so cute and so dark all at the same time.  Sheesh.” - Jon Klassen (from the back cover). Just when I through I figured out the story arc, it would take another dramatic turn.  Well worth tracking down.
